Answer:

Genetic variation occurs.

Mutations are not copied over and over again.

Explanation:

Meiosis is a type of cell division that adds genetic variations in the progeny through the process of crossing over. These genetic variations impart a survival advantage to the population and prevent species extinction under unfavorable conditions. Since crossing over during meiosis produces new gene combinations, meiosis does not always allow transmission of mutation to the progeny. In this way, it helps to get rid of harmful mutations.
